Cardamom Sweet Tea
Description: I've learned two new cuisines in my year so far spent in the South: Southern food, and Indian food. This brings them together.
Ingredients:
- 1 gallon water
- 4 family-size tea bags (I recommend Luzianne)
- 10 -12 cardamom pods
- 25 g Splenda sugar substitute (or 200g sugar)
Steps:
- Bring two quarts of water, with the cardamom pods, to boil in a pot.
- Remove from heat and add the tea bags.
- Cover and let steep five minutes.
- Remove the tea bags and the cardamom.
- Put the Splenda or sugar in a gallon pitcher and add the tea.
- Fill the pitcher the rest of the way with cold water, chill, and enjoy.
